CES: Yahoo unveils TV plan

  12 votes
Recommend
Yahoo Connected TV got a boost of publicity at CES 2009 as Yahoo unveiled a list of HDTV partners. Yahoo is hoping that despite the tough economy, consumers will connect with its new WebTV venture. The company unveiled new partners including Sony, LG Electronics and Samsung Electronics at the Consumer Electronics Show in Las Vegas, Nevada. Bobbi Rebell reports.
